Break the habit of self-comparison
Regardless of how confident we generally are, at some point, we start comparing our lives with others who might appear more successful. We think doing so will somehow push us more and bring the best out of us, but believe us, it won’t.
So instead of the self-comparison method, why not try something new? Open your arms, and give yourself a hug. Self-acceptance is the key.
Let’s say you want to quit a bad habit. Won’t it be a great start if you just embraced who you are without criticizing yourself? Charge yourself with self-compassion, and you can find your way out of any darkness.

6 tips to embrace the defeat and move on
We think you’ll find these tips exceptionally helpful:
- Accept your mistakes, learn from them, and put them in your past. Don’t judge yourself too much. What’s done is done.
- Sometimes, instead of worrying about how far you must go to achieve a goal, you must look behind and see how far you’ve come. It will ignite the fire in you to do even better.
- Came across an opportunity that seems a bit too challenging? Maybe a twist of perspective can help! Why not see a possibility in problems. Won’t that be much better? Grab every opportunity that comes in your way. But be wise in choosing. Take note of the challenges, their solutions, or other possibilities in your way.
- Here’s a rule you must stick to: You have to accept that success and failure are a combo pack. You can’t escape one if you want the other.
- Did you have a setback and are looking for someone to take your hand and pull you out? The best person who can help you is YOU. Have some consoling self-talk. Convince yourself that you can do it again, and you can do it better despite the odds.
